Comprehending IELTS
Before diving into the exam dates for Uzbekistan, it is very important to understand what the IELTS exam involves. The Ielts Uzbekistan Test Venue assesses the language proficiency of prospects in 4 areas: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. There are 2 types of IELTS tests-- Academic and General Training. The Academic IELTS is usually taken by people who want to register in greater education, while the General Training variation is fit for those looking to immigrate or work.

2. For how long are IELTS scores legitimate?
IELTS ratings are typically legitimate for 2 years. After this period, prospects might be needed to retake the exam.
3. Can I change my exam date after registration?
Yes, you can change your exam date, but this typically includes a fee and needs to be done within a specified timeframe before the original test date.
4. What identification is needed for the IELTS exam?
Candidates must bring a legitimate passport or nationwide ID card. It must be the same identification utilized during registration.
